Transaction 03e91a96ff1057591d4ac4afff37ff047aa07ef5d59fd024b4c48ba61a55404e

7 Input
2 Outputs
  • 03e91a96ff1057591d4ac4afff37ff047aa07ef5d59fd024b4c48ba61a55404e:0
  • value  46957
    address  16K4fbMVxkvF5f6TRTqsvyfJ4HK5rVPYtb
  • 03e91a96ff1057591d4ac4afff37ff047aa07ef5d59fd024b4c48ba61a55404e:1
  • value  8137580
    address  14yrRAVBVa9YF7Re1SxNrmm1peuDwRFgnD